As a significant feature of vehicle, the color feature plays an important role in the intelligent transportation systems. However, the color feature is easily affected by the variations of the lighting condition. In this paper, we present a new method for vehicle color recognition, which is based on license plate color. The color of license plate is recognized by the prior knowledge and the recognition result of the license plate, which is not sensitive to the variations of lighting condition. We select the vehicle ROI (region of interest) near the license plate, and convert the color space of the plate image and the vehicle ROI image from RGB to HSV. The vehicle color is identified by the relative location of the ROI color and the plate color in the spectrum. We verify the feasibility of our approach through a comparison experiment. Experiment results show that the color of license plate is helpful to recognize the vehicle color.
